Understanding the Role of an Accident Injury Settlement Attorney
Accidents can lead to considerable physical, psychological, and monetary distress. When incidents happen, such as car crashes, slip and falls, or workplace injuries, victims typically find themselves having a hard time to recuperate medical costs and lost earnings. This is where an accident injury settlement attorney comes into play. These lawyers assist victims of accident accidents navigate the complexities of the legal system to protect reasonable compensation. This article dives into the functions of an accident injury settlement attorney, the settlement procedure, and frequently asked questions surrounding this field.
What is an Accident Injury Settlement Attorney?
An accident injury settlement attorney focuses on representing individuals who have been injured due to somebody else's carelessness or misdeed. These attorneys are experienced in accident law and are skilled at negotiating settlements with insurance companies or opposing counsel.

When pursuing an injury claim, there's a sequence of useful steps involved in the settlement process. Below is a breakdown:
Initial Consultation: The victim meets an attorney to go over the case.Case Investigation: The attorney investigates the event to gather essential proof.Need Letter: A need letter is drafted and sent out to the insurance business describing the case and the compensation requested.Negotiation Phase: The insurance business examines the demand and may react with a settlement deal. Competence in the Law
Browsing the legal landscape can be frustrating, especially for individuals without legal training. Accident injury lawyers have specialized knowledge about injury law, helping clients understand their rights and legal options.
2. Making the most of Compensation
Attorneys understand the subtleties of figuring out reasonable compensation, which includes medical costs, lost wages, and pain and suffering. They are trained negotiators, making sure victims receive the best possible settlement.
3. Managing the Paperwork
The legal procedure involves mountains of documents, from filing claims to court paperwork. An attorney manages this workload, permitting victims to focus on their recovery.
4. Contingency Fee Structure
A lot of personal injury lawyers deal with a contingency charge basis, indicating they just get paid if the customer wins the case. This plan minimizes monetary stress for victims looking for legal representation.
Often Asked Questions (FAQ)Q1: How much does it cost to employ an accident injury settlement attorney?
Most personal injury attorneys work on a contingency cost basis. This means their cost is a portion of the settlement awarded, usually ranging from 25% to 40%.
Q2: How long do I have to file a claim?
The timeframe to file a claim varies by state, often ranging from one to three years from the date of the accident. It's crucial to seek advice from an attorney as quickly as possible to avoid missing out on the deadline.
Q3: What kinds of cases do these lawyers manage?
Accident injury attorneys manage a wide variety of cases, consisting of but not restricted to:
Car accidentsSlip and fall accidentsOffice injuriesMedical malpracticeItem liability claimsQ4: What if the insurance provider denies my claim?
If a claim is rejected, an attorney can help appeal the decision and might even take the case to court to seek proper compensation.
Q5: Can I settle without an attorney?
While it's possible to settle a claim without legal representation, doing so can be risky. Insurer typically aim to minimize payout, so having an experienced attorney can considerably enhance the chances of getting reasonable compensation.
